Lincoln Memorial and Queens Ranked in NABC/Division II Preseason Top-25
KANSAS CITY, Mo. - The 2019-20 NABC/Division II preseason poll was released on Tuesday (Oct. 29) with Lincoln Memorial and Queens representing the South Atlantic Conference in the top-25.
Lincoln Memorial is picked No. 6 after finishing the 2018-19 season with a record of 20-9, while Queens is Picked No. 8 after advancing to the NCAA Division II Elite Eight a season ago and finishing with a record of 31-5 overall.
Catawba also received votes in the preseason poll, falling just short of the top-25.
